Abstract:
Agilent Technologies (Agilent) is a leading supplier of electronic test and
measurement products, including data generators, multi-meters, and
oscilloscopes. It was formed in 1999 with the spin-off from Hewlett- Packard's
measurement business. Agilent faces many risks. Recovery in the telecom markets
is not expected for some time. Agilent has also seen a drop in the recovery of
the semiconductor and associated semiconductor capital equipment markets.
Agilent's future depends significantly on the pace of recovery in these markets.
Agilent has frozen hiring and reduced all discretionary spending.
|
|
The company has also initiated short-term closures of plants
to reduce production levels. Agilent believes that it has the cost structure as
well as innovative products to compete effectively. As competition increases, it
remains to be seen how Agilent will cope with uncertainty in the years to come.
The case helps MBA students understand how a company can integrate risk
management in strategic planning.
